Alex Forencich
|
aef62af18c
|
modules/mqnic: Associate messages with netdev
Signed-off-by: Alex Forencich <alex@alexforencich.com>
|
2023-05-03 22:24:19 -07:00 |
|
Alex Forencich
|
335c731ef0
|
modules/mqnic: Implement ethtool reg dump API
Signed-off-by: Alex Forencich <alex@alexforencich.com>
|
2023-05-03 17:44:14 -07:00 |
|
Alex Forencich
|
e76bc8128c
|
modules/mqnic: Implement ethtool rxfh API
Signed-off-by: Alex Forencich <alex@alexforencich.com>
|
2023-05-03 16:54:37 -07:00 |
|
Alex Forencich
|
32db67b066
|
modules/mqnic: Improve indirection table handling
Signed-off-by: Alex Forencich <alex@alexforencich.com>
|
2023-05-03 16:50:59 -07:00 |
|
Alex Forencich
|
eecaef6e6f
|
modules/mqnic: Add some additional range enforcement
Signed-off-by: Alex Forencich <alex@alexforencich.com>
|
2023-05-03 16:49:28 -07:00 |
|
Alex Forencich
|
7cd40a8e1e
|
modules/mqnic: Minor cleanup
Signed-off-by: Alex Forencich <alex@alexforencich.com>
|
2023-05-03 16:48:26 -07:00 |
|
Alex Forencich
|
a6da3a41cb
|
modules/mqnic: Implement ethtool channels API
Signed-off-by: Alex Forencich <alex@alexforencich.com>
|
2023-05-03 01:35:01 -07:00 |
|
Alex Forencich
|
3302c1f832
|
modules/mqnic: Implement ethtool ringparam API
Signed-off-by: Alex Forencich <alex@alexforencich.com>
|
2023-05-03 01:22:12 -07:00 |
|
Joachim Foerster
|
db1bb30745
|
modules/mqnic: Export link status via ethtool
Makes ethtool show the usual "Link detected" line.
Signed-off-by: Joachim Foerster <joachim.foerster@missinglinkelectronics.com>
|
2022-05-23 13:59:46 -07:00 |
|
Alex Forencich
|
8fbe46aa31
|
Update ethtool API implementation
|
2022-03-22 23:48:13 -07:00 |
|
Alex Forencich
|
c118565d21
|
Fix EEPROM-related error handling in ethtool interface code
|
2022-03-20 23:07:45 -07:00 |
|
Alex Forencich
|
137a6778da
|
Combine interface control blocks
|
2022-01-15 21:53:13 -08:00 |
|
Alex Forencich
|
0f82e0c5f3
|
Fix ethtool firmware version number reporting
|
2022-01-10 11:18:58 -08:00 |
|
Alex Forencich
|
ce21774f06
|
Register space reorganization
|
2021-12-29 22:31:46 -08:00 |
|
Alex Forencich
|
27c9241a69
|
Update header comment, add SPDX license identifiers
|
2021-10-21 14:55:48 -07:00 |
|
Alex Forencich
|
df4c1c9db7
|
Use strscpy instead of strncpy
|
2021-10-21 14:45:22 -07:00 |
|
Alex Forencich
|
2adaf820b5
|
More kernel module coding style updates
|
2021-10-21 13:54:00 -07:00 |
|
Alex Forencich
|
5b49f09baa
|
Fix kernel module coding style
|
2021-10-08 18:31:53 -07:00 |
|
Alex Forencich
|
1bce5827c9
|
Rework ethtool get_ts_info implementation
|
2021-10-08 17:47:22 -07:00 |
|
Alex Forencich
|
4294e5ea1d
|
Use BIT macros
|
2021-10-08 16:55:56 -07:00 |
|
Alex Forencich
|
8bf38e20c7
|
Add missing includes
|
2021-08-20 18:08:22 -07:00 |
|
Alex Forencich
|
945b2d3206
|
Add ethtool support for reading module EEPROMs
|
2020-09-19 17:25:58 -07:00 |
|
Alex Forencich
|
e60e3a993f
|
Add device object reference in mqnic_dev and clean up references to device object
|
2020-07-30 19:37:34 -07:00 |
|
Alex Forencich
|
6c5b6c99a1
|
Initial commit of mqnic kernel module
|
2019-07-17 18:13:51 -07:00 |
|